Cooking Steps

Cook the potatoes
1
  • Boil the kettle. Half-fill a medium saucepan with boiling water and add a generous pinch of salt.
  • Cut potato into bite-sized chunks. 
  • Finely chop parsley.
  • Cook potato in the boiling water, over high heat, until easily pierced with fork, 12-15 minutes. Drain and return to saucepan.
  • Add parsley and the butter. Toss to coat and season to taste.
Get prepped
2
  • Meanwhile, cut capsicum and tomato into bite-sized chunks.
  • Thinly slice brown onion (see ingredients).
  • Cut bacon into 1cm pieces. 
Cook the pork
3
  • In a large frying pan, heat a drizzle of olive oil over medium-high heat.
  • When oil is hot, cook pork steaks until cooked through, 3-4 minutes each side (cook in batches if your pan is getting crowded).
  • Transfer to a plate, cover and rest for 5 minutes.
Start the lecsó
4
  • While the pork is cooking, in a second medium saucepan, heat a drizzle of olive oil over medium-high heat.
  • Cook bacon until golden, 2-3 minutes.
  • Add capsicum, tomato and onion and cook, until tender, 5-6 minutes
Finish the lecsó
5
  • Add paprika spice blend, stock concentrate and the water.
  • Reduce heat to medium, then cover with a lid and simmer, until thickened, 3-5 minutes.
Finish & serve
6
  • Slice pork.
  • Divide Hungarian pork steak, parsley potatoes and smokey bacon lecsó between plates. Enjoy!
